NC State Dining is the heart of campus nourishment, operating 10 cafes, 3 food courts, 6 dining halls, 4 markets, a full-service restaurant, catering, vending, and nutritional counseling. Powered by a dedicated team of 1,000+ student and temporary staff alongside 190 permanent professionals, we are committed to service, quality, and community.
